In recent years, empirical studies of first dripping and now flooding in, that there is a link between diet and acne. A prerequisite for research is that eating refined carbohydrates and sugar is the main culprit for many individuals with acne problems. Scientific theory is that when carbohydrates and sugars lead to increased metabolism of insulin and insulin-like growth factor known as IGF-1 production. This growth factor causes the male hormones that began to be produced in the body in much larger quantities. These growth hormones directly lead to an increase in the quantity of sebum produced. Mazu is a fat-like substance that comes from your pores, which people often describe as “oily skin”. Sebum then clogs your pores and then let the bacteria build up in these pores can not escape because of sebum. This is of course ultimately leads to acne.
This fairly exhaustive explanation explains just that, and when you eat carbohydrates and refined sugar can aggravate the skin, clogging your pores, and develop acne.
